diff --git a/src_main/io/pisharedmemory.cpp b/src_main/io/pisharedmemory.cpp index f79d488e..e283f41a 100644 --- a/src_main/io/pisharedmemory.cpp +++ b/src_main/io/pisharedmemory.cpp @@ -85,7 +85,7 @@ PISharedMemory::PISharedMemory(const PIString & shm_name, int size, PIIODevice:: bool PISharedMemory::openDevice() { close(); - piCoutObj << "try open" << path() << dsize; + //piCoutObj << "try open" << path() << dsize; #ifdef WINDOWS PRIVATE->name = ("PIP_SHM_" + path()).toByteArray(); PRIVATE->name.push_back(0); @@ -96,14 +96,14 @@ bool PISharedMemory::openDevice() { PRIVATE->map = CreateFileMapping(INVALID_HANDLE_VALUE, NULL, PAGE_READWRITE, 0, (DWORD)dsize, nm); //piCoutObj << "create map =" << ullong(PRIVATE->map); if (!PRIVATE->map) { - piCoutObj << path() << dsize << "CreateFileMapping error," << errorString(); + piCoutObj << "CreateFileMapping error," << errorString(); return false; } } PRIVATE->data = MapViewOfFile(PRIVATE->map, FILE_MAP_ALL_ACCESS, 0, 0, dsize); if (!PRIVATE->data) { - piCoutObj << path() << dsize << "MapViewOfFile error," << errorString(); CloseHandle(PRIVATE->map); + piCoutObj << "MapViewOfFile error," << errorString(); return false; } //piCout << PRIVATE->map << PRIVATE->data; @@ -118,7 +118,7 @@ bool PISharedMemory::openDevice() { fd = shm_open((const char *)PRIVATE->name.data(), O_RDWR | O_CREAT, 0777); //piCoutObj << "try create" << PICoutManipulators::Hex << (m | O_CREAT) << fd; if (fd < 0) { - //piCoutObj << "shm_open error," << errorString(); + piCoutObj << "shm_open error," << errorString(); return false; } PRIVATE->owner = true;